八进制42等于
来源:学生作业帮助网 编辑:作业帮 时间:2024/10/06 21:46:19
关于八进制和十六进制的正负性,有如下几种情况:1.如果直接使用,都认为是正值,比如printf("%d",2*0x8008);输出655522.如果将其赋值给有符号变量,则(化为二进制后)最高位为1表
前面加个符号位,正的是0,负的是1,一般用逗号隔开.如(1,10)B=(-2)DB是二进制D是十进制数的表示有三种:原码,反码,补码具体的网上都能查的.我简要说下,一看就能懂正数的三种都是一样的,即符
下面给出二进位制与八进位制的对应表示二进位..八进位001,...1010,...2011,...3100,...4101,...5110,...6111,...7000,...0您还有疑问吗?
275.42,每位,变成3位二进制数,如下:010111101.100010整理,即:10111101.10001
8进制转10进制:也与2进制转10进制相同,以小数点为分界线,编号,小数点后的一位为-1,二位-2,个位数为0,十位数为1,百位为2……依次类推,编号数就是8的次数例如:(254.23)8转换成10进
是时钟信号输入端(下降沿有效),Q3、Q2、Q1、Q0是输出8421BCD码,计数值由0(0000)到9(1001).第二片采用5进制计数模式,clkb是时钟输入(下降沿有效),Q3、Q2、Q1是输出
把一个74161的Q3作为这一级的进位输出端,它就是一个八进制计数器.第一级的4个输出端(Q3,Q2,Q1,Q0)就是8,4,2,1.这个第一级的计数输入是从CLK端输入的,第二级的CLK接第一级的Q
可以方便的和2进制互相进行转换.
inta=8;printf("%o",a);输出10
8进制逢8进一,和10进制逢10进一一个道理8进制里是看不到数字8的所以是10再问:我都觉得是10,但是我在Java语言程序设计的课后习题看,它的答案是0x10。这是为什么?再答:0x在c语言里是16
4121求采纳再问:是4321吧。再答:4121再问:我想问下。比如,八进制数1234转换成十进制数是668。然后668转换八进制还能是1234么?再答:是的可以互换的
首先回答你第一个问题:110101这个二进制的数可以使用位权法去做也就是1*2零次方+0*2的一次方+1*2二次方+0*2的三次方+1*2的四次方+1*2的五次方=53第二个问题:八进制数2507一样
三位二进制数为111(B)=7(D)1位8进制为7(D)=78进制逢8进13位二进制也是逢8进1故相等再问:我是菜鸟。能再解释下“BD”是什么意思么?
整数从小数点开始右向左,每三位一个单位转换为一位八进制数.小数从小数点向右每三位一个单位转换.例如:101111100001.1100110115741.633
-1511
其实2进制换八进制十六进制都有这种简单的方法,如果你想要其他方法,还有一种就是2^5+2^3+2^2+2^1=X*8^1+Y*8^0这样也可以算出来的,也可以直接换成十进制的数,再换成八进制的;一般的
八进制是以8为基数的一种计数系统.在八进制系统中,你是这样计数的:O,1,2,3,4,5,6,7,10,ll,12,13,等等.下面比较了八进制(第二行)和十进制(第一行)中的计数过程:O,l,2,3
转成八进制的时候3位一组,转换成十六进制的时候4位一组.位数不够补00.10000110转八进制0.100,001,100(补0,小数点后的0反正不影响其值)即0.414(八进制)0.10000110
所谓几进制,就是每个位是用几做基数.如十进制第一位是10的0次方就是1,第二位是10的1次方就是10,第三位是100..那么8进制,从右边起第一位权是1,第二位权是8,第三位权是64,.51除以8=6